Shriners Children's is the premier pediatric burn, orthopaedic, spinal cord injury, cleft lip and palate, and pediatric subspecialties medical center. We have an opportunity for a Global Patient Services Supervisor reporting into our Corporate Headquarters location.
The Global Patient Services Supervisor is responsible for overseeing the Global Patient Services program for a defined region of the world with a team of Global Patient Services Coordinators and Specialists. The Supervisor will serve as Leader on Call for the international acute burn/injury program, covering 24/7 shifts and holding responsibility for the program while Leader on Call. The Supervisor will take a lead role in coordinating the evaluation and acceptance process for high priority international patients. As Supervisor for a defined region, s/he will create and implement country-specific processes and documentation to comply with local countries’ fraternal, social, and regulatory environments.
Furthering the Shriners Children's international mission and congruent with the Shriners Children's vision for growth and development, the Supervisor will support efficient international patient program processes across the Shriners Children's system and within the fraternity.

The Central Service Technician decontaminates, cleans, assembles, requisitions, stores, and sterilizes supplies, instruments sets, and trays according to policy and procedure while using aseptic technique. Works closely with OR personnel and is responsible for the OR case carts and maintaining the OR / CS supply room and supporting other Hospital departments with their sterilization needs.

Child Life Specialist minimize anxiety and aid children and adolescents in coping with the hospital experience. Promotes normal growth and development through provision of age appropriate opportunities for play, learning, self-expression, family involvement, and peer interaction. Acts as a resource to staff, patients, families, and the general public regarding assigned areas of responsibility.
